15x15 Pergola Plans - What used to be called the patio roof is now known as a pergola. It offers shelter from sun, rain, and wind and also extends your living space. A significant architectural feature pergolas comprise rafters, beams, and posts. They are able to be connected or removed from a home. While opinions vary on the distinction between a pergola and an gazebo, typically it is freestanding and is built with a pitched roof while a pergola's roof is flat. Arbor and pergola are frequently used interchangeably, however an arbor is structure designed to support vines or guide foot traffic in a garden.

With the growing popularity of outdoor living spaces, it could enhance the value of your home. Before jumping into an pergola project, take note of the followingfactors:
Orientation: North, south, east, or west-facing.
Materials: This could include plywood to hardwood metals, prefabricated material as well as glass, fabric and.
Budgeting: Two of the biggest expenses are materials and labor. If your budget is limited (and that's most of us) here's the point where resourcefulness, clever planning the ability to DIY, as well as the ability to think on your feet come into play.
Contractor vs. DIY: Who is planning to build the project? Do you want to do it yourself project or do you want to hire an expert? A prefabricated pergola kit is an alternative.
Building codes: And who will create it? The majority of outdoor structures require the approval of an inspector of buildings or a the planning commissioner. The local government office will provide guidelines for setbacks and height restrictions.
Zone laws: Are need to obtain city or county zoning regulations and approvals? Depending on where you live the process could take a lot of time, so stay on top of it if your goal is to have to complete the project within the next few months or even year. Committees sometimes meet sporadically and applications can fall into the wrong hands.

If you are considering adding a pergola or pergola to your landscape, the first thing you need to decide on is whether you want it custom or a kit. A local landscape designer can help you design a pergola and then build it in your yard.
Materials will be your next decision. There are many choices available, and all have their advantages and disadvantages.
Wood pergolas made of pressure-treated timber: This is the most affordable option. Although they will last a long time, pressure-treated lumber may crack, warp, or become damaged over time. This pergola is best if stained or painted.
Cedar wood: Cedar (typically Western Red Cedar) is a popular choice for pergolas. It's insect-resistant and looks great right out of the mill. To make it soft and silvery gray, you can leave it as is or seal it with stain. Cedar pergolas can be more expensive than pressure-treated ones, but they will typically last for a much longer time.
Vinyl: Vinyl pergolas are very easy to maintain. Vinyl pergolas can not be painted, so there are only a few color options.
Fiberglass: Fiberglass pergolas can be expensive but offer many benefits. Fiberglass is strong and can be spanned for longer distances (in some cases up to 20 feet), giving you a cleaner look. Fiberglass can be painted any color you want, and the paint will hold up better than on wood. Finally, fiberglass pergolas are perfect for adding to either a deck or existing patio. Due to their light weight, fiberglass pergolas don't require the same deep footers as other materials dictate.

15x15 Pergola Plans - Difference Between Pergolas And Pavilions
These structures are often beautiful and attractive. However, some pergola owners may find it difficult to get adequate protection from the weather due to the open design. A pergola with a solid roof may be an option for those who want to provide more protection from the elements.
Pavilions are pergolas that have a roof. Although they are quite similar in design, a pavilion is a freestanding pergola with a fixed roof that generally completely covers the pergola.
A pergola is an area that can be used to create a protected area in your garden. The posts support the roof grid of beams or rafters. These posts can be attached to your home or left freestanding.
They can also be referred to as gazebos, though that distinction is usually left to smaller and more decorative structures that are found in gardens. These roofs can be fixed or retractable. A retractable awning, also known as a retractable pergola, is one example.

Gardens come with a variety of sizes, so it is important to think about what you want when choosing between pergolas and gazebos. Traditional pergolas are rectangular or square in shape, while gazebos come with a wide range of shapes. Gazebos may be square, rectangular or hexagonal.
The decision on whether to get a pergola, gazebo, or both depends on how big your garden is. Both structures add great value to your home. You could also get both! A gazebo provides the perfect shelter for a hot tub, whilst your seating area sits under the pergola.
